From 417c80669681ef1e069195e185fe8b3e6f0a1f86 Mon Sep 17 00:00:00 2001 From: BrettMayson Date: Wed, 15 Jan 2025 21:07:07 -0600 Subject: [PATCH 1/2] fix nginx ingress when tls is off --- charts/vaultwarden/templates/ingress.yaml | 2 ++ 1 file changed, 2 insertions(+) diff --git a/charts/vaultwarden/templates/ingress.yaml b/charts/vaultwarden/templates/ingress.yaml index 780e830..bd5ebf7 100644 --- a/charts/vaultwarden/templates/ingress.yaml +++ b/charts/vaultwarden/templates/ingress.yaml @@ -31,8 +31,10 @@ metadata: {{- end }} nginx.ingress.kubernetes.io/connection-proxy-header: "keep-alive" nginx.ingress.kubernetes.io/enable-cors: "true" + {{- if $ingress.tls }} nginx.ingress.kubernetes.io/ssl-redirect: "true" nginx.ingress.kubernetes.io/force-ssl-redirect: "true" + {{ - end }} nginx.ingress.kubernetes.io/limit-connections: "25" nginx.ingress.kubernetes.io/limit-rps: "15" nginx.ingress.kubernetes.io/proxy-body-size: 1024m From 38f350d4fdcd2d7839e651f20cbba8d314b5dade Mon Sep 17 00:00:00 2001 From: Brett Mayson Date: Thu, 6 Feb 2025 00:04:49 -0600 Subject: [PATCH 2/2] bump 0.31.5 --- charts/vaultwarden/Chart.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/charts/vaultwarden/Chart.yaml b/charts/vaultwarden/Chart.yaml index fdaa468..f1a24ab 100644 --- a/charts/vaultwarden/Chart.yaml +++ b/charts/vaultwarden/Chart.yaml @@ -13,5 +13,5 @@ maintainers: - name: guerzon email: guerzon@proton.me url: https://github.com/guerzon -version: 0.31.4 +version: 0.31.5 kubeVersion: ">=1.12.0-0"